服务器端数据的接收与存储

核心上文小编总结:构建高可用、高安全且低延迟的数据接收与存储架构,是现代互联网业务稳定运行的基石,其关键在于采用异步解耦的接收机制、分层分级的存储策略以及全链路的数据校验体系,单纯依赖单一数据库已无法满足海量并发场景,必须通过引入消息队列缓冲流量洪峰,结合对象存储与关系型数据库的混合架构,并辅以自动化备份与监控,才能实现数据在高并发写入下的零丢失与秒级响应。
高并发下的数据接收:从同步阻塞到异步解耦
在传统架构中,服务器端往往采用同步阻塞模式处理数据请求,即“接收 – 处理 – 存储”串行执行,一旦遭遇流量洪峰,数据库连接池极易耗尽,导致服务雪崩,现代架构的核心突破在于引入消息队列(MQ)作为流量削峰填谷的缓冲层。
当用户发起数据提交请求时,服务端不再直接写入数据库,而是将数据封装为消息投递至消息中间件(如 Kafka、RabbitMQ 或 RocketMQ),这一过程将I/O 密集型的数据库操作与CPU 密集型的业务逻辑彻底解耦,接收端仅需完成消息的持久化投递,即可立即返回成功响应,将响应时间压缩至毫秒级。
独家经验案例:在某电商大促活动中,酷番云(Kufan Cloud)为其客户构建了基于酷番云消息队列服务的接收架构,面对每秒十万级的下单请求,系统通过自动扩缩容的队列节点,瞬间吸收了 90% 的流量冲击,后端消费者集群根据数据库的实际负载,以平滑速率从队列拉取数据并写入存储层,实测数据显示,该方案在峰值期间业务可用性维持在 99.99%,彻底杜绝了因数据库连接超时导致的订单丢失问题。
分层分级存储策略:匹配数据生命周期
数据并非铁板一块,不同类型的业务数据对性能、一致性及成本的要求截然不同,专业的存储方案必须遵循分层分级原则,根据数据的访问频率、重要程度及生命周期进行精细化布局。

- 热数据层(Hot Data):对于高频读写、强一致性的核心业务数据(如用户账户、交易订单),应采用高性能分布式关系型数据库(如 MySQL 集群或 PostgreSQL),通过读写分离与主从复制机制,保障主库的高可用性与从库的查询分担,确保核心交易数据的ACID 特性不受影响。
- 温数据层(Warm Data):对于日志、操作记录等访问频率中等的数据,建议采用NoSQL 数据库(如 MongoDB 或 Redis Cluster),利用其灵活的 Schema 设计与高吞吐量特性,支撑海量非结构化数据的快速写入与检索。
- 冷数据层(Cold Data):对于归档数据、历史备份及多媒体文件,应迁移至对象存储(Object Storage),对象存储具备近乎无限的扩展能力与极低的存储成本,配合生命周期管理策略,可自动将旧数据转储至低成本存储介质,实现成本与性能的最优平衡。
独家经验案例:某金融科技企业利用酷番云对象存储与酷番云云数据库的混合架构,重构了其数据中台,系统将实时交易数据存入云数据库,而将过去三年的历史交易流水自动归档至对象存储的低频访问层,这一策略不仅将整体存储成本降低了60%,更使得历史数据查询速度提升了3 倍,完美解决了传统架构中“存得多、查得慢”的痛点。
数据安全性与完整性:构建全链路防护网
数据接收与存储的终极目标是确保数据的真实性与完整性,任何环节的疏忽都可能导致不可逆的数据灾难。
必须实施全链路数据校验,在数据接收入口,通过数字签名与哈希校验(如 SHA-256)验证数据完整性,防止数据在传输过程中被篡改,建立多副本冗余机制,无论是数据库还是对象存储,都必须开启多可用区(Multi-AZ)部署,确保在单点故障发生时,数据能自动切换至备用节点,实现RPO(数据恢复点目标)趋近于零。
自动化备份策略是最后一道防线,应实施全量备份 + 增量备份的组合策略,并定期进行异地灾备演练,酷番云提供的云备份服务支持秒级快照与跨地域复制,确保在极端灾难场景下,企业数据能在分钟级内完成恢复,保障业务连续性。
监控与运维:从被动响应到主动预防
没有监控的存储系统是盲目的,必须建立立体化的监控体系,涵盖网络带宽、磁盘 I/O、CPU 负载、数据库连接数及队列积压量等关键指标,利用智能告警系统,当指标出现异常趋势时,提前触发告警,将故障消灭在萌芽状态,通过日志分析与链路追踪,快速定位数据延迟或丢失的根本原因,形成闭环优化。

相关问答(Q&A)
Q1:在数据量激增时,如何避免数据库写入成为系统瓶颈?
A1:核心策略是读写分离与异步削峰,不要试图让数据库直接处理所有写入请求,应引入消息队列(如酷番云消息队列)作为缓冲,将同步写入改为异步消费,对数据库进行分库分表,将大表拆分为多个小表分散压力,并配合读写分离架构,将查询流量引导至从库,从而最大化数据库的写入吞吐量。
Q2:如何确保数据在传输和存储过程中不被篡改或泄露?
A2:需构建端到端的安全防护体系,传输层强制使用HTTPS/TLS 加密,防止中间人攻击;应用层采用数字签名技术验证数据完整性;存储层开启加密存储功能,确保落盘数据即使被窃取也无法解密,实施严格的权限最小化原则,仅授权必要人员访问敏感数据,并开启全量审计日志,确保所有操作可追溯。
互动环节
您在构建数据架构时,是否遇到过因数据量激增导致的存储瓶颈?或者在数据迁移过程中有过哪些独特的踩坑经验?欢迎在评论区分享您的实战案例,我们将邀请酷番云资深架构师为您进行专业点评与解答。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/410968.html


评论列表(3条)
这篇文章写得非常好,内容丰富,观点清晰,让我受益匪浅。特别是关于独家经验案例的部分,分析得很到位,给了我很多新的启发和思考。感谢作者的精心创作和分享,期待看到更多这样高质量的内容!
读了这篇文章,我深有感触。作者对独家经验案例的理解非常深刻,论述也很有逻辑性。内容既有理论深度,又有实践指导意义,确实是一篇值得细细品味的好文章。希望作者能继续创作更多优秀的作品!
读了这篇文章,我深有感触。作者对独家经验案例的理解非常深刻,论述也很有逻辑性。内容既有理论深度,又有实践指导意义,确实是一篇值得细细品味的好文章。希望作者能继续创作更多优秀的作品!